linux是一个免费开源的操作系统,具有高可用性,可靠性和可移植性的特点。但是,由于这里的Linux字符编码格式是不可见的,当用户浏览某些数据时,经常会遇到”乱码”。这往往会导致严重的损失,比如无法查看网页内容,或者无法正确运行应用程序等等。
面对这个问题,我们不应该恐慌,只要解决它就可以了。所以乱码最重要的原因被定位为编码不匹配,也就是说文件的编码格式与浏览器不匹配,那么怎么办呢?
重要的是要设置正确地字符编码格式。
首先,确定Linux终端使用的字符集,可以用如下命令查看:
“`shell
echo $LANG
打出的结果如“en_US.utf-8”即为Linux系统使用的字符编码
其次,确保浏览器访问的页面编码与系统的编码一致,可以在浏览器的设置中找到“标准字符集”或“默认字符集”等选项,将之设置为Linux系统使用的字符编码,例如“utf-8”。
最后,要注意文件的编码,数据库的编码等,尤其是文件的编码,都必须正确设置为当前Linux操作系统使用的字符编码,以此来避免乱码的出现。
当文件的编码和系统使用的字符编码不匹配时,可以使用“iconv”这个工具,转换文件的编码格式,以匹配Linux系统使用的字符编码,以解决乱码问题。
总而言之,Linux输出的乱码问题,可以通过设置正确字符编码格式,以及使用iconv工具转换文件编码等方法,来有效解决。
成都创新互联建站主营:成都网站建设、网站维护、网站改版的网站建设公司,提供成都网站制作、成都网站建设、成都网站推广、成都网站优化seo、响应式移动网站开发制作等网站服务。
当前题目:Linux输出的乱码,何去何从?(linux输出乱码)
标题来源:http://www.csdahua.cn/qtweb/news27/336977.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网